As anticipation builds for the launch of the iPhone 18 Pro series next month, exciting details about its technological advancements have begun to emerge. Central to this new lineup is the A20 Pro chipset, which is rumored to leverage TSMC's groundbreaking 2nm manufacturing process. Recent insights indicate that the A20 Pro will deliver impressive performance improvements while maintaining energy efficiency, although these advancements come with a notable increase in production costs.
According to the reliable tipster Fixed Focus Digital on Weibo, the upcoming A20 Pro chipset is expected to boast around an 18% performance enhancement compared to its predecessor, the A19 Pro. The innovative Gate-All-Around (GAA) technology utilized in this new chipset is also expected to significantly enhance power efficiency, with the A20 Pro reportedly consuming up to 30% less power than the previous model.
However, the new chipset's advanced manufacturing process comes at a cost. Reports suggest that the increased complexity and resource requirements for the A20 Pro could elevate the overall bill of materials (BOM) for the iPhone 18 Pro by up to 40%. Coupled with a current shortage of memory components, this could drive the starting price of the iPhone 18 Pro to approximately $1,399.
